Opinion

Dewey, J.

This was an action of debt by the State Bank of Indiana against Atkinson, the maker of a promissory note, in the Washington Circuit Court. The defendant pleaded in abatement the pendency of another suit in the Jackson Circuit Court on the same note, against Atkinson and others. The other defendants were indorsers of the note
